WebJul 11, 2015 · HEG (Hemoencephalography) is a specific neurofeedback technique that trains users to consciously regulate cortical blood flow. The practice is based off of the idea that with enough “neurological feedback” (provided by an HEG device) a person becomes able to consciously control an unconscious process (blood flow).
